I'm building a new HTPC and wanted some advice on the integrated graphics card.
I thought I'd build it based on Intel and it consists of Intel Pentium G6950, 2GB DDR3 RAM and Gigabyte GA-H55M-S2H. The HTPC would be used for movies only (it should be able to play 1080p with no problems, no matter how complex the encoding or whatever it makes the hardware hard to show it properly). Here's the problem - I can't decide between Pentium's or Core i3's 530 integrated graphics, because the latter has a 200MHz higher clock. Would that be relevant to movie watching?
